Affiliate Marketing: How to make money as an affiliate blogger

Seven awesome tips to make affiliate marketing more profitable in your online business! Whether you're looking FOR affiliates or looking TO affiliate, this post has awesome tips (as I do both). #blogging #bloggers #affiliates via @pullingcurls

Affiliate marketing can be a VERY profitable revenue source for bloggers.  This post is going to tell you how to how to get started and stay profitable!

Why should a blogger do affiliate marketing?

Affiliate marketing makes up about 30% of my revenue stream, and conversely — Affiliates market about 1/3 of my courses.

It can be EXTREMELY effective for both sides of the isle (and be sure to grab my seven sweet tips)

Advantages to Affiliate Marketing for Bloggers

Forever

Instead of writing one sponsored post, getting your $500 dollars (or whatever) affiliate posts can make you money for MONTHS at a time.

I have made tens of thousands off of ONE post.  It can be HIGHLY lucrative

Your Voice

I can write an affiliate post HOWEVER I think it will sell best.  Sometimes companies have particular restraints (especially medicine devices) but often they give you free reign.

I also then promote it as I see fit.  I don’t have to tag them in promotions (looking at you Facebook).  I love that about it.

Share stuff you love

If you love a particular company, see if they have an affiliate program.  Most of my top earners are companies I would recommend with or without the income.  That’s just a huge bonus.

As far as companies to go with my #1 tip is to find something you use already.  Often those brand area on networks.  The 3 I use most frequently are:

  • Commission Junction
  • Share-A-Sale
  • FlexOffers

Advantages to Affiliate Marketing for Companies

Low pressure

I take the risk and write the post — then, we see what comes of it.  I only earn if I sell.

So the risk on your end is a lot less than paying me to write a post.

I will promote it myself

The blogger takes on promoting it, and if she/he is good — they will do advertising for you that you wouldn’t even have thought of.

Instead of setting up Facebook campaigns, you have me.  And again, you only pay me if you sell.

Incorporate them

A lot of companies love that I promote them, because I have an RN behind my name, and I’m also good to put a testimonial on their review page.

Tips for companies

  1. Put it out there that you have an affiliate program.  Make it easy to access, and use a portal that bloggers can see into, if at all possible
  2. Make commissions high enough that it perks attention from bloggers.  Check around for industry standards.
  3. Talk to bloggers — see what they want.  Great places to find them are people who have tagged you on social media!
  4. Don’t change it.  You might be tempted to lower commissions or change your program.  But don’t.  You need to be in this for the long-term as well.
  5. Offer incentives in the beginning.  Tell bloggers who get X number o sales, that you’ll send them an Amazon gift card — that way your program can be SOLID (and you don’t change it) but you also lure them in for the initial push.
  6. Keep in touch — don’t let them forget about you.  I also have an email series that all my new affiliates go through to remind them awesome ways to promote ME and make us BOTH rich! 🙂
